Output 4339166843620f5895743f7af6627f6ffa80f9c6f100a0dd69858c9b0f85ea60:3

value
536670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e869406a2d61bf666f85fc4352f813e12db79246 OP_EQUAL
address
3Nstn4PM9znojDrWejw88ewvpdWWRFwidY
transaction
4339166843620f5895743f7af6627f6ffa80f9c6f100a0dd69858c9b0f85ea60
spent
true